Background
Birkhead, Claude Vivian was born on May 27, 1880 in Phoenix, Oregon, United States. Son of Joseph Chenoweth and Mary Jane (Jennings) Birkhead.

Student Fort Worth U., 1898-1899. Honorary Doctor of Laws, 1941.
Admitted to Texas bar, 1899, practiced at San Antonio since 1904. Senior member Birkhead, Beckmann, Standard, Vance & Wood. Appointed judge 73d District, 1910, re-elected 4 year term, resigned, 1912.
City attorney San Antonio, 1920-1921. Counsel San Antonio District Federal Loan Agency. President and general counsel, Commercial Cattle Loan Company.
General counsel Grayburg Oil Corporation, San Antonio Insurance Exchange, San Antonio Real Estate Board. Counsel Nueces Valley Authority. Chairman trustees, general counsel Nix Memorial Hospital.
Special attorney appointed by Texas Legislature to represent Texas coastal land claims before Congress, 1939. Chairman San Antonio United States-Texas Centennial Committee, 1936-1937. Chairman Democratic National Campaign Committee, Bexar County, Texas, 1936-1937.
Chairman Fire and Police Civil Service Board, 1931-1936. Colonel 131st Field Artillery, United States Army. American Expeditionary Force, 1917-1919.
Chief of staff, 36th Division, Texas National Guard, 1919-1923. Brigadier general, 1923-1936. Major general (N.G.U.S.) Army of the United States, commanding 36th Division Texas, National Guard, 1936.
Command general Camp Bowie, Texas, and 36th Division Army of the United States, 1940-1941. Commanding general Internal Security Forces, 3d Service Commanded, 1942. Retired from active service, June 30, 1942.
Lieutenant general Texas State Guard Reserve Corps, commanding.
Member American, Texas State and San Antonio bar associations Fraternal Society Law Association, International Association of Insurance Counsel. Mason (K.T.).; Club: Fort Sam Houston Officers’.
Married Lillian Alice Guessaz, December 6, 1905. Children: Betty Jane, Mary Annual.
